The Creed familyLouis, Rachel, their children Ellie and Gage, and their pet cat Churchmove from Chicago to rural Ludlow, Maine, after Louis accepts a job as a physician with the University of Maine. It was the reason that Rachel had such deep-seated issues about death; she was the one forced to care for her sister the fateful day Zelda finally succumbed to her illness. Zelda suffered from an illness,, Spinal Meningitis, and as a result was bed ridden and became burdensome for both her parents and Rachel. Rachel was born to Irwin and Dory Goldman and had an older sister named Zelda, who was terminally ill and grotesquely disfigured by her illness, and could not care for herself.
